Thomson Reuters Foundation’s global pro bono legal programme TrustLaw, in partnership with international law firm Allen & Overy, is hosting a special legal workshop in Warsaw for NGOs and social enterprises. This bespoke event will give organisations the opportunity to speak directly with lawyers to explore how pro bono legal support can help your organisation achieve even greater impact.

Lawyers from Allen & Overy LLP and Woźniak Legal will be available to discuss a broad range of topics, from addressing common operational legal needs which your organisation may face such as commercial contracts, corporate governance, employment law, intellectual property, data protection and charity law, to providing legal guidance on your organisation’s advocacy efforts to create meaningful change at a grassroots level.

The workshop will be conducted in Polish and will be an opportunity to meet other high-impact organisations and network with participating lawyers.

This is a free workshop. Coffee, tea and sandwiches will be provided.
